Immunocore (NASDAQ: IMCR) is a pioneering, commercial-stage T cell receptor biotechnology company whose purpose is to develop and commercialize a new generation of transformative medicines which address unmet patient needs in oncology, infectious diseases and autoimmune disease. Our leaders in R&D are internationally recognised as some of the biotech industry's most successful drug developers. We are creating not just an environment where great minds can interact but an innovation powerhouse answering the big questions.

Focused on delivering first-in-class biological therapies to patients, we have developed a highly innovative soluble TCR platform. Our ImmTAX molecules underpin a new generation of precision engineered drugs that harness the immune system to treat a broad spectrum of diseases with high unmet medical need, including oncology, infectious diseases and autoimmune diseases.

Responsibilities include:

  • Providing focused bioinformatics expertise to support the analysis and data management of translational biomarker data.
  • Thoroughly exploring publicly available data together with emerging data from Immunocore's clinical trials to provide new insights into mechanism of action, molecular heterogeneity of disease and novel targets.
  • Conducting the analysis of transcriptomic and genomic sequencing data from our clinical trials.
  • Complimenting and developing our scientific hypotheses through the mining of public data and the design and analysis of our own in-house experiments.
  • Developing custom-made tools and analytics to assist interpretation and data visualisation.
  • Maintaining and increasing technical knowledge in relevant fields through self-study, observation, attending relevant conferences and training courses.
  • Operating in accordance with the Company's Health and Safety policies.
  • Independently testing and leading lines of investigation in data analysis.
  • Proposing new analyses based on emerging data and other related information.
  • Establishing priorities for own work and team-based projects; making decisions on prioritisation based on the overall goals of the team, department and project.
  • Acting as a mentor or manager to other colleagues, especially new hires, sharing scientific and company knowledge.
  • Providing analysis of new techniques and theories from outside the Company to advance the way the company works.
  • Championing and helping others to understand Health & Safety within the company, providing ad-hoc training as required.
  • Communicating and presenting research findings at meetings with colleagues, senior management and partners.

Required skills and qualifications:

  • Proficient in R/BioConductor, Linux OS and shell scripting bash.
  • Proven programming ability (Knowledge of at least one language, preferably Python).
  • Understanding of molecular biology, cell biology, immunology or related discipline.
  • Significant experience of independent research in academic or industrial setting, or transferable skills gained from professional experience.
  • Experience of building next generation sequencing (NGS) analytical pipelines.
  • Led a project small team, formally or informally, including project management.
  • Experience of developing databases, using SQL or similar, and pairing with a user-friendly interface.
  • Mentored and coached less experienced colleagues in scientific practices and theory.
  • Knowledge of machine learning, applied statistics or related field is a plus.
  • PhD in a scientific discipline with a minimum of 2-5 years of relevant experience (post-doctoral experience may be included) - preferred.
  • MSc degree or BSc degree with equivalent research or industrial experience specific to the role - required.
